Question 876473: Find the center, and the lengths of the transverse and conjugate axes of the hyperbola.Get the equation into standard form for a hyperbola.
Find the center, and the lengths of the transverse and conjugate axes.

9x^2+ 126x - 16y^2 + 288y - 999 = 0
complete the square:
9(x^2+ 14x +49) - 16(y^2 - 18y + 81) = 999+441-1296
9(x+7)^2-16(y-9)^2=144
%28x%2B7%29%5E2%2F16-%28y-9%29%5E2%2F9=1
This is an equation of a hyperbola with horizontal transverse axis.
Its standard form of equation: %28x-y%29%5E2%2Fa%5E2-%28y-k%29%5E2%2Fb%5E2=1, (h,k)=coordinates of center
For given hyperbola:
center: (-7, 9)
a^2=16
a=4
length of transverse axis=2a=8
b^2=9
b=3
length of conjugate axis=2b=6
